#e4a666 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4a666 is composed of 89.4% red, 65.1%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.2%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 30.5 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 64.7%. #e4a666 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#c94d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e4a666 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4a666 has RGB values of R:228, G:166,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.55,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14984806.

Shades and Tints of #e4a666
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0802 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4a666
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a5a4 is the less saturated color, while #f9a651 is the most saturated one.
